Optics courses can help you learn about light behavior, lens design, wave-particle duality, and optical instruments. You can build skills in ray tracing, optical testing, and understanding the principles of diffraction and interference. Many courses introduce tools like CAD software for designing optical systems, simulation software for modeling light propagation, and measurement devices used in laboratories to analyze optical phenomena.
